Processing Times: Typical Scenarios

e-Visa (Online Application)

Most nationalities can apply online for a UAE e-Visa, processed in 2–5 working days. Apply at least 1 week before travel.

Clock starts after complete document submission and fee payment.

Regular Visa (Embassy / VAC)

Paper-based visas take longer. Tourist/business visas: 5–15 working days; Employment/Student/Residence: 3–6 weeks.

    Refund & Cancellation Policy

    Visa application fees are non-refundable under normal circumstances. Refunds are granted only if payment is deducted but the application was not initiated. Always check with the official portal or embassy before requesting a refund.

    Urgent / Express Processing Fees

    Visa TypeStandard FeeExpress FeeProcessing Time
    Tourist VisaUS$90–120US$180–22024–48 hours
    Business VisaUS$120–150US$220–2802–3 days
    Transit VisaUS$30–50US$70–90Same day
